19-year-old escaped jungle justice to face court trial over theft


Hassan Umar, a 19-year-old man was on Friday brought before a Lagos Magistrate court over a two count charge of stealing an Itel phone valued at N13,500, Glo recharge card worth N1000 and cash of N4000.

One of the victim told Graca Gist that the accused, who went ahead to steal from another shop at Dopemu few hours after he stole from a shop at oshodi, was about to be burnt by the angry mob before Policemen on patrol rescued him from jingle justice.

The prosecutor, Insp. Clement Okuoimose, told the court that the offenses were committed on Wednesday, May 17, 2017.

Clement said that the accused stole an Itel phone belonging to Mrs. Funmilayo Adeeyo who resides at 15, Ariyibi Oke Street Oshodi, Lagos and N13,500, Glo recharge card worth N1000 and cash of N4000 belong to one Keji Ademosu, who resides at 161, Dopemu road Agege.

He told the court that the offences contravened Sections 285 of the Criminal Law of Lagos State, 2015.

However, Hassan who pleaded guilty at the Police station made a 'U-turn' and pleaded not guilty at the court.

The Chief Magistrate, Mrs Y.O Ekogbulu, granted bail to the accused in the sum of N20, 000, with two sureties in like sum with evidence of Tax particulars.

Ekogbulu adjourned the case until June 28.
